AIDAN O’BRIEN’S massive Derby favourite The Lion In Winter is a huge drifter in the market.

And stablemate Delacroix has been absolutely smashed into favourite.

Acomb Stakes winner The Lion In Winter – who flopped in key trial the Dante at York – is out to a huge 11 (10-1) on the Betfair Exchange.

Coral reported a surge of bets for Coolmore-owned stablemate Delacroix, who looks like being the mount of Ryan Moore.

Coral’s David Stevens said: “Since Aidan O’Brien’s comments earlier this week that Ryan Moore would find it difficult not to ride Delacroix at Epsom, the Leopardstown Trial winner has been the best-backed Derby contender by far.

“He has regained outright favouritism for the Classic, in contrast to The Lion In Winter, who has now been eased to 6-1 for next Saturday’s race.”

Some bookies went as big as 7-1 for The Lion In Winter, who spent months at the head of the betting.

Derby sponsors Betfred are just 15-8 Delacroix, who has been mighty impressive in two wins this season and looks like he will have no problem with the 1m4f trip and undulating track.

The Lion In Winter was keen and all over the shop in the Dante on his return from 267 days off.

O’Brien, who has seen superstar stayer Kyprios retired just weeks ahead of a tilt at a third Gold Cup at Royal Ascot, insisted the run wasn’t as bad as it looked.

But, much like Kyprios, it looks like the markets are telling the story ahead of next Saturday’s £1.5million blockbuster race.
